SAFETY REQUIREMENTS : HDi DIRECT INJECTION SYSTEM  
XSARA - XSARA PICASSO  
Engines : RHY - RHZ  
SAFETY REQUIREMENTS  
Preamble.  
All interventions on the injection system must be carried out to conform with the following requirements and regulations :  
- Competent health authorities.  
- Accident prevention.  
- Environmental protection.  
WARNING : Repairs must be carried out by specialised personnel informed of the safety requirements and of the precautions to be taken.  
Safety requirements.  
IMPERATIVE : Take into account the very high pressures in the high pressure fuel circuit (1350 bars), and respect  
the requirements below :  
- No smoking in proximity to the high pressure circuit when work is being carried out.  
- Avoid working close to flame or sparks.  
Engine running :  
- Do not work on the high pressure fuel circuit.  
- Always stay clear of the trajectory of any possible jet of fuel, which could cause serious injuries.  
- Do not place your hand close to any leak in the high pressure fuel circuit.  
After the engine has stopped, wait 30 seconds before any intervention.  
NOTE : This waiting time is necessary in order to allow the high pressure fuel circuit to return to atmospheric pressure.

SAFETY REQUIREMENTS : HDi DIRECT INJECTION SYSTEM  
XSARA - XSARA PICASSO  
Engines : RHY - RHZ  
CLEANLINESS REQUIREMENTS.  
Preliminary operations  
IMPERATIVE : The technician should wear clean overalls.  
Before working on the injection system, it may be necessary to clean the apertures of the following sensitive components : (refer to corresponding  
procedures).  
- Fuel filter.  
- High pressure fuel pump.  
- High pressure fuel injection common rail.  
- High pressure fuel pipes  
- Diesel injector carriers.  
IMPERATIVE : After dismantling, immediately block the apertures of the sensitive components with plugs, to avoid the entry of impurities.  
Work area.  
- The work area must be clean and free of clutter.  
- Components being worked on must be protected from dust contamination.

ADJUSTING THE DELPHI MECHANICAL INJECTION PUMP CONTROLS  
XSARA  
Engines : WJZ - WJY  
Adjusting the fast idle.  
Engine cold.  
- Ensure that the lever (2) is up against its stop to the right.  
- If not, adjust the tension of the cable (3) using the cable clamp (1).  
- Finish tensioning using the sleeve tensioner (4).  
Engine hot.  
- Check that the cable (3) is in tension.  
Checking the thermostatic sensor.  
- There should be a minimum 6 mm cable travel between a cold and a hot engine.  
Adjusting the accelerator control.  
Prior conditions.  
- Engine hot (cooling fan is engaged twice).  
Checking the accelerator cable tension.  
- Fully depress the accelerator pedal.  
- Check that the lever (6) is against its stop (5) otherwise, alter the position of the pin.  
- If not, adjust the position of the accelerator cable tensioning retaining pin.  
- Ensure that in the idle position the lever (6) is against the stop (7).

XSARA  
ADJUSTING THE DELPHI MECHANICAL INJECTION PUMP CONTROLS  
Engines : WJZ - WJY (continued)  
Adjusting the anti-stall (residual output).  
- Insert a 3 mm thick shim (10) between the throttle lever (6) and the anti-stall screw (7).  
- Push the stop lever (8).  
- Insert a 3 mm diameter peg (9) in the lever (2).  
- Adjust the engine speed to 1500 rpm ± 100 using the stop screw (7).  
- Remove the shim (10) and the peg (9).  
Adjusting the idle speed.  
- Adjust the speed using the idle adjustment screw (11).  
- Idling speed : 825 ± 25 rpm.  
Checking the engine deceleration.  
- Move the throttle lever (6) to obtain an engine speed of 3000 rpm.  
- Release the throttle lever (6).  
- The deceleration should be between 2.5 and 3.5 seconds.  
- The drop should be approximately 50 rpm in relation to the idle speed.  
- Deceleration too fast, (the engine has a tendency to stall) slacken the screw (7) by a quarter turn.  
- Deceleration too slow, (engine speed is greater than the idle speed) tighten screw (7) by a quarter turn.  
NOTE : In each case, check the idle speed for any necessary adjustments.

XSARA - XSARA PICASSO  
FITTING BOSCH INJECTORS  
Engine : RHY  
Evolution : Classification of diesel injector carriers  
Reminder : RHY and RHZ are equipped with 4 diesel injector carriers marked according to their injection  
duct diameters (flow of diesel fuel).  
16/11/98 #  
Identification.  
The injector carriers have an engraving or paint mark on the upper part of the coil, close to the diesel fuel  
return aperture :  
Mark 1 = BLUE paint mark = Injector class 1.  
Mark 2 = GREEN paint mark = Injector class 2.  
Identification marking:  
a : Supplier identification.  
b : PSA identification no.  
c : Identification of class.  
After Sales operations.  
ESSENTIAL : When changing a diesel injector carrier, order a component of the same class.  
# 15/11/98 (RPO No.) (injector carrier without marking), always order a class 2 injector carrier.
